Now that we have the logic to stack dm-tables for partitions we can
handle BSD 'c' slices (which span the entire disk) properly.

+       /*
+        * Convention has it that the bsd disklabel will always have
+        * the 'c' partition spanning the entire disk.
+        * So we have to check for contained slices.
+        */
+       for(i = 0; i < n; i++) {
+               if (sp[i].size == 0)
+                       continue;
+
+               end = sp[i].start + sp[i].size;
+               for(j = 0; j < n; j ++) {
+                       if ( i == j )
+                               continue;
+                       if (sp[j].size == 0)
+                               continue;
+
+                       if (sp[i].start < sp[j].start) {
+                               if (end > sp[j].start &&
+                                   end < sp[j].start + sp[j].size) {
+                                       /* Invalid slice */
+                                       fprintf(stderr,
+                                               "bsd_disklabel: slice %d overlaps with %d\n", i , j);
+                                       sp[i].size = 0;
+                               }
+                       } else {
+                               if (end <= sp[j].start + sp[j].size) {
+                                       sp[i].container = j + 1;
+                               }
+                       }
+               }
+       }
